Over 15 million litres of illicit brew destroyed, Kibicho says

Interior Principal Secretary Engineer Karanja Kibicho said the fight against killer brews is bearing fruit.
speaking in Mwea, Embu County on Monday during the issuance of title deeds to the residents, Kibicho said over 15 million liters of illicit brews have been destroyed by the government since the ministry of interior launched the massive fight against the lethal drinks.
The PS said that the illicit brew menace has caused real damage to the youths, noting that over 50,000 youths have lost their lives due to illicit brews in the Mt Kenya region alone, a situation that has worried the nation.
Kibicho further said that various county commissioners and national administration officials have been sued by the brewers, insisting that the government will not be cowed by a few who are bent on destroying the youth.
“The government will not relent in ensuring that the community is saved from the wrath of a few who are enriching themselves using the blood of the dejected in society,” said Kibicho.
The PS also called on the community, the church, and the political class to support the national administration officials in the fight against the killer brews.
